Hi,
I've searched this forum a few times, but I couldn't find a thread discussing the best brand of oil for our engines. Anyone have anything they like to use? Anyone got a used oil analysis done comparing different brands?
I've used Pennzoil Platinum and Pennzoil Ultra in my previous Mazda3. They came highly recommended for the Mazda MZR engine by Mazda3 forums and BITOG (bobistheoilguy.com).
I was wondering if anyone had some impressive results with a particular oil for the Suzuki engine. I plan to keep using Platinum or Ultra at this point. Both are highly regarded for their cleaning abilities among other qualities. It's also cheaper than Mobil 1.
Also, anyone like a particular oil filter?

I noticed in the owner's manual Suzuki recommends Shell engine oils. (Not that I'm suggesting it is the best oil to use.)
If you've got a warranty it's probably best to stick with the genuine oil filters. If something goes wrong it's one less way for them to try and get out of a warranty claim.

I usually use 0W20 Amsoil or 5W30 mobil 1 fully synthetic. I find using 5W30 make the engine hard to turn over in winter.

During the last winter here in Slovakia, the temps dropped to about -15C (5F). I have a 5W30 oil in the Kizzy (can't remember the brand, the dealer did the change) and the engine always started without any hesitation.
